AI anxiety refers to the apprehension, fear, or unease individuals or groups experience regarding the development, deployment, and societal impact of artificial intelligence technologies. This anxiety can manifest in various forms, including concerns over job displacement, privacy erosion, ethical dilemmas, loss of control, and existential risks.
